Should businesses use AI to create marketing content?
AI can help businesses research, plan and draft content, but it should not replace human expertise, judgement or brand knowledge. The strongest content combines AI efficiency with real experience, original examples and careful review. That helps avoid generic output and gives customers something useful, credible and distinctive rather than more content that sounds like everyone else.
Does website content still matter for SEO and AI search?
Yes. Website content still supports SEO and is increasingly important for AI search because search engines and AI platforms need clear, credible information to understand your business. Strong service pages, useful articles, case studies and expert commentary can improve visibility, demonstrate authority and give both people and AI systems better information to work with.
How do I know what content my customers want?
Start with the questions, problems and decisions your customers regularly bring to your team. Sales conversations, search data, website behaviour, customer feedback and industry changes can all reveal useful topics. The goal is to create content around genuine customer needs, then choose the format and channel that best help people understand, compare or take action.
How often should a business publish content?
There is no ideal publishing frequency for every business. Consistency matters, but quality and relevance matter more than filling a calendar. A useful schedule depends on your audience, objectives, available expertise and channels. Publishing fewer strong pieces with a clear purpose can be more valuable than producing frequent content that adds little new information or insight.
What type of content should my business create?
The most effective content format depends on what you need the audience to understand or do. Detailed topics may suit articles or guides, proof of experience may work best as case studies, and timely updates can suit email or social media. Video is useful when something is easier to demonstrate than explain in writing.
Can content marketing help generate leads?
Content marketing can support lead generation by helping potential customers understand your services, answer questions and build confidence before they contact you. Useful website content, case studies, email communications and thought leadership can support different stages of the buying journey. The strongest content connects directly to a business objective rather than generating attention for its own sake.
